Wayne Center For The Arts

Wayne Center For The Arts reported paying Sara Starr Brink, Executive Director, $84,000 in total compensation (FY 2024).

That places Sara Starr Brink at approximately the 46th percentile among 181 similarly sized arts, culture & humanities nonprofits (median $87,836).
